The foreign exchange market (or forex) is one of the most liquid in the world. There are several factors that influence the prices of the currencies in this market, including interest rates, inflation, terms of trade, and current account deficits. Higher interest rates attract foreign capital, which increases the exchange rate. Therefore, forex traders may trade based on announcements from central banks announcing changes to interest rates.

Forex positions are quoted in currency pairs, which means that traders are speculating on the exchange rates of two currencies. The EUR/USD is the most popular currency pair in the forex market, although other major pairs such as GBP/USD, USD/CHF, USD/CAD, and AUD/USD are also widely traded.

Another important concept in forex trading is leverage, which allows a trader to borrow a portion of their capital to enter a position. This increases the trader’s profits but also increases losses. The difference between the value of the total position and the money borrowed by the broker is known as the margin. This process is a risky one, and can lead to loss of all of your capital.
